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) – Overnight Shift
Join our client’s healthcare team in the Bronx as a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A), providing essential overnight care in a fast-paced clinical setting. This role is ideal for experienced CNAs who are passionate about delivering high-quality, compassionate care during nighttime hours. You’ll work collaboratively with nursing staff to ensure patients receive continuous support, comfort, and safety throughout the night.
Key Responsibilities
-
Direct Patient Care: Assist patients with personal hygiene activities such as bathing, grooming, and toileting, especially those with limited mobility.
-
Meal & Medication Support: Help patients with eating and monitor their adherence to prescribed medication regimens.
-
Room Readiness: Prepare and maintain patient rooms with necessary medical supplies and personal comfort items.
-
Mobility Assistance: Safely transfer patients between beds, wheelchairs, and other equipment; support walking exercises and mobility routines.
-
Vital Sign Monitoring: Observe and record vital signs and changes in patient behavior; promptly report any concerns to nursing or medical staff.
-
Comfort & Preventive Care: Reposition patients regularly to prevent pressure ulcers and maintain physical comfort during the night.
